Ryan Hope Travis is a nationally recognized actor, director, theater-maker, and multi-hyphenate filmmaker whose work often addresses issues of social change. As a multi-hyphenate filmmaker (i.e., writer, director, and cinematographer), Ryan has 10 short films to his credit, with several having their world premieres at film festivals in New York City, Austin, Miami, Los Angeles, and the Academy Award-qualifying, Atlanta Film Festival. His debut feature film, Cocoa in the Dark, is in post-production. He has taught at Syracuse University, Colgate University, and Hobart and William Smith Colleges, and now is an Assistant Professor in Acting at the University of Florida. He has served as Executive Artistic Director of the Paul Robeson Performing Arts Company in Syracuse, NY and the Youth Project Director and Engaging Men Project Coordinator at Peace Over Violence in Los Angeles. He is the founder and lead filmmaker of Arcable, a film production company dedicated to producing works of art rooted in social commentary.
